CA 2266126

An expansive osteosynthesis implant comprises branches (5) connected by one of their ends to a tube cap (7) pierced by an orifice (8), which can be slid from the rear between the vertebral disks of two consecutive vertebrae, so as to maintain them at a set distance and restore the stability of the spinal column. Said branches (5) and said tube cap (7) define a hollow sheath which, in inoperative position, has a general cylindrical external shape with circular cross section and at least part of the internal volume (9) of the sheath (1) towards the distal ends of the branches (5), is in the shape of a revolving truncated cone with its larger base on the side of said tube cap (7). This implant comprises at least three branches (5) and at least one wedge (2) capable of passing into said orifice (8) and through the larger base of the truncated cone into said internal volume (9).
